Senior Vice President & Chief Operating Officer, Lahey Clinic

Position Summary:

Lahey Clinic is seeking a dynamic and experienced Senior Vice President, Chief Operating Officer (COO) to lead hospital operations and drive strategic execution across the organization. Reporting to the President, the COO will play a critical role in advancing operational excellence, enhancing patient-centered care, and delivering strong organizational performance across a leading academic health system.

This is a highly visible leadership role responsible for aligning operations with enterprise strategy, fostering collaboration across BILH, and elevating quality, efficiency, and patient experience.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ead day-to-day hospital and ambulatory operations to ensure high-quality, safe, and efficient care delivery
  • Execute strategic and operational plans in partnership with executive leadership, physician leaders, and academic stakeholders
  • Build credibility and trust across leadership, physicians, clinicians, and staff through visible, transparent communication, with a strong emphasis on physician engagement and partnership in an academic environment
  • Establish and sustain strong relationships with physicians and academic leaders, maintaining a consistent presence across departments to foster collaboration and advance academic medicine
  • Drive performance improvement through data, metrics, and best practices
  • Partner on service line growth, business development, and market expansion
  • Strengthen patient experience, clinical quality, and operational outcomes
  • Lead, develop, and mentor senior leaders within a complex, matrixed organization
  • Ensure compliance with all regulatory, legal, and accreditation standards
  • Serve as a key ambassador across BILH and within the community

Qualifications:

  • Master’s degree in healthcare administration, business, or related field (clinical background preferred)
  • 10+ years of healthcare leadership experience, including at least 5 executive-level roles
  • Experience within a multi-hospital or academic health system strongly preferred
  • Experience in service line operations, program development, and physician relations

Pay Range:

$500,000.00 USD - $520,000.00 USD

The pay range listed for this position is the annual base salary range the organization reasonably and in good faith expects to pay for this position at this time. In addition to base compensation, this position may be eligible for additional compensation, which may include performance-based incentive bonuses.
